22 May 2008, 3:00 pm
The California Labor Commissioner's Office has issued an order prohibiting Contemporary Floors, Inc. and its CEO and president, Timothy Allen Kennady, from bidding on or receiving any public works contracts for three years as part of a settlement in which Contemporary Floors agreed to pay more than $245,000 in wages due, liquidated damages and penalties.
